5. GENERAL SPECIFICATIONS for Furnishing Works
These specifications are for work to be done, items to be supplied and materials to be used in the
works as shown and defined on the drawings and described herein, to the satisfaction of the Owner /
Architect
1 GENERAL:
1.1 The workmanship is to be the best possible and of a high standard. The contactor shall take all steps
immediately to make up deficiency if any noticed by the Owner / Architect. Use must be made of
special tradesmen in all aspects of the work and allowance must be made in the rates for the same.
1.2 The materials to be provided by the contractor shall be in accordance with the samples already got
approved from the Owner / Architect by the Contractor and in conformity with specification and
approved list of manufactures and brand. The contractor shall produce all invoices, vouchers or
receipts for any materials if called upon to do so by the Owner / Architect.
1.3 Samples of materials are to be submitted to the Owner / Architect for their approval before th
contractor orders or delivers the materials to the site. Samples together with their packing are
to be provided free of charge by the Contractor and should any materials be rejected they
will be removed from the site at the contractors expense.
All samples will be retained by the Owners / Architects for comparison with materials which will be
delivered at site. Also the contractor will be required to submit specimen finishes of colours, fabrics etc.
for the approval of the Owners / Architects before proceeding with the works.
1.4 The contractor shall be responsible for providing and maintaining temporary covering required for the
protection of finished work. He is also to clean out all wood shavings, cut ends and other waste from all
parts of the works before covering or infillings are constructed.
1.5 All guarantees & warranties provided by manufacturer of all products used are to be handed over in
original to the owner on completion of work.
2 Joinery in wood work:
2.1 The contact surface between internal frame and skinning shall be glued with approved adhesive in
addition to fixing with necessary screws etc.,
2.2 After preparing proper surface of skinning by sand-papering etc., the laminates or veneers shall be
fixed on it with the help of approved adhesives.
2.3 Framework for full height partitions shall be rigidly fixed to the floor, walls, and ceiling soffit. The
partition height shall be measured upto bottom of false ceiling and framing members /ply going above
the ceiling shall not be measured.
2.4 Any portions that are warped or found with other defects are to be replaced. The whole of the work is
to be finished in accordance with the detailed drawings and the direction of Owner / Architect.
2.5 All joints shall be standard mortise and tenon, dowel, or cross halved. Screws, nails etc. will be of
standard iron or wire. Tenons should fit the mortise exactly.
2.6 Nailed or glued butt joints will not be permitted.
2.7 Wherever screw heads are on a finished surface, those will be sunk and the hole plugged with a wood
plug of the same wood and grain to match the colour.
3 Timber:
3.1 All the wood to be used shall be properly seasoned, of natural growth and shall be free from worm
holes, loose or dead knots or other defects. Wood will be sawn square and shall not suffer warping
splitting or other defects. Teakwood & Malaysian Sal should be of Ist quality.
3.2 The moisture content shall not exceed 12%
3.3 All internal frame work shall be treated with approved wood preservative and with fire retardant
treatment / paint.
3.4 All wood brought to site should be clean & not have any preservative or coating.
3.5 All rejected or decayed wood shall be immediately removed from site
3.6 All the dimensions mentioned for T.W. members are finished sizes.
3.7 All T.W lipping & beading samples are to be approved by architects before usage.
4 Plywood:
4.1 Waterproof Plywood shall generally conform to BIS 303-1989, bonded with phenol formaldehyde.
Commercial plywood shall generally confirm to BIS 303-1989, bonded with melamine urea -
formaldehyde.
5 Block board:
5.1 All block board specified will be phenol formaldehyde bonded, confirming to BIS 1659-1990.
6 Hardware and Metals:
6.1 All the screws / bolts with nuts to be used shall have oxidized finish (unless required otherwise) of
approved shape, size, and quality.
6.2 Samples of all hardware are required to be approved by in advance.
6.3 The agency should protect all hardware with suitable material as necessary and subsequently clean it
at the time of handing over.
6.4 All hardware shall be fitted with good workmanship without the surroundings edges being damaged.
6.5 All castors shall be approved make, quality and type. They shall be glass reinforced nylon castors.
7 Laminate:
7.1 All laminates shall be 1.5mm thick of approved make.
7.2 The contractors shall get the sample showing the surface texture, pattern and colour approved,
by Owners / Architect.
7.3 All laminate edges should be exposed. All laminate, plywood and block board edges will be covered
with TW lipping / beading as specified.
8 Glazier:
8.1 All glass is to be approved manufacture, complying with BIS 2835 - 1977, or as per approved quality
and sample. Glass to be of the qualities specified and free from bubbles, air holes, waviness and other
defects.
8.2 In cutting the glass, proper allowance shall be made for expansion.
8.3 Glass for mirror shall be silvering quality (SQ) conforming to BIS 3438 - 1977 or as approved samples
and quality.
8.4 On completion, glass surfaces shall be cleaned inside and out, all cracked, scratched Glass /
mirror shall be replaced.
9 Paints and Polishes:
9.1 All materials required for the works shall be specified and approved manufacture, delivered to the site
in the manufacturer's containers with the seals, etc., unbroken and after use empty containers shall be
stored till finally cleared by the Owners.
9.2 All iron or steel / metal surfaces shall be thoroughly scraped and rubbed down with wire brushes and
shall be entirely free from rust mill scale, etc. before applying the primary coat.
9.3 Enamel paint to plywood & melamine polish to wood surfaces to be done using approved putty and
techniques and paint from approved manufacture.
9.4 Painting works shall be of high standard without any brush marks on the finished surfaces and
nose parts on adjacent furniture, glass etc.,.
5. GENERAL SPECIFICATIONS for Electrical Works
I GENERAL
a. This specification applies to all medium voltage power distribution control panels / meter boards /
equipments / materials covered in the quantities / schedule of items.
b. All the panels, distribution / control boards, meter boards and equipments / materials covered in the
'Schedule' include design, manufacture, supply, installation,erection, testing and commissioning. These
items also include making trenches / ducts, foundation, making recess in walls wherever necessary,
fixing the distribution boards flush with the finished wall surface to plumb and proper levels, finishing
masonry work that has been disturbed for electrical works making all the cable connections both
incoming and outgoing earthing connections, providing cable supports, suitable covers for trenches /
ducts inside the buildings, necessary fasteners, painting, writing the names of feeders etc. with paint
and any other minor work incidental to the main work of installation and commissioning as directed by
the Engineer in charge.
c. The requirements of the power panels and distribution boards are clearly indicated in the 'Schedule'.
The contractor shall prepare and submit to the 'Employer' for their approval the drawings for all the
panels, distribution / control boards before fabricating them. The supplies should be as per approved
drawings.
d. All the equipments, power panels, distribution / control boards and meter boards shall be manufactured
fully complying with the requirements of the relevant Indian Standard Specifications of latest issue.
II SWITCH GEAR
a. All the switchgear items such as MCCBs, SFUs, change over switches, MCBs, CTs, Meters, SFUs,
Neutral links, indication lamps, Relays, Capacitors, Bus bars, internal connections, terminals for
external cable connections etc., shall be housed in suitable cubicles as required. Design, construction,
enclosures, doors' interlocking, earthing, marking and testing shall be in accordance with IS:3427 and
the degree of protection shall be IP 54 of IS:2147. Clearance between phases and between phases
and neutral and earth shall not be less than 25mm.
b. There shall be a separate cubicle / compartment for each incoming side. The outgoing feeders and
controls may be arranged in a multi-tier form of cubicles with provision for 1 or 2 more future additions.
The height of cubicles shall not be more than 2mt. All or some of the incoming and outgoing cables
shall be either at the bottom or top of the cubicles necessitated by site conditions and this shall be
studied and determined before fabrication and assembly of the cubicles.
c. All doors shall be hinged type except bus bar chamber covers which shall be bolted type. Suitable inter
locking arrangements shall be provided between the front cover / door of MCCB/SFUs so that the front
cover is openable only when the main switch gears are in 'OFF' position.
d.
III
a
b.
Wiring for metering, indicator lamps and control circuits shall be done with 1100V grade,
stranded, tinned annealed copper conductors and PVC insulated. For measuring circuits, 2.5
sq.mm size and for other circuits 1.5 sq.mm size wires shall be used. Coloured cables shall be
employed for identification of phases and neutral. Wiring shall be neat and properly clamped.
SUB SWITCH BOARDS (SSB/PDBs) AND LIGHTING DISTRIBUTION BOARDS
(LDBs), SERVICE / METER BOARDS
All the SSBs, PDBs, LDBs, Service/Meter Boards shall be of robust construction and suitable for flush
mounting on walls / floor. Compartmentalised and fabricated out of 16 swg sheet steel with M.S angles
and channels of suitable sizes wherever necessary, totally enclosed, fully gasketted, dust and vermin
proof, removable top and bottom plates with suitable knock-outs at appropriate locations for entry of
20, 25 and 40 mm dia, PVC/MS conduits, hinged front doors (single or two half doors depending upon
the size of the board) with locking arrangement, two earthing terminals etc.
Service / Meter boards housing front operated SFUs, terminal blocks, sealable fuse cut outs, KWH
meters etc., shall be provided with suitable arrangements for locking and sealing front door. Suitable
cut outs and glass windows in front of KWH meters shall be provided for taking readings and watching
meter's working. this should be strictly as per TNEB Requirements.
IV MINIATURE CIRCUIT BREAKER (MCB) AND ISOLATORS MCBs are required for both 3 phase and single phase in TPN and SPN grouping for "ON LOAD"
switching operation and also protection of distribution circuits of 440 V against over load and short
circuit faults. Actual requirements viz combination, current rating, number of sets etc. are given in the
"Schedule". The MCBs shall conform in all respects to IS:8828 and have short circuit rating of 9 KA, as
specified.
V WIRING All the interconnections between the incoming, bus and outgoing of 100A and above rating shall be
done by insulated copper strips of suitable sizes. Switch fuses and equipments below 100 A rating
shall be wired with insulated copper conductors. The wiring for instruments, protection and control
equipment shall be carried out by means of pressure clamps, special washers, etc. The wiring shall be
terminated by using crimping sockets. Wiring shall be laid out neatly in bunches which are firmly
fastened to the steel members of the panels. All the potential circuit shall be protected by fuses
mounted near the top off point form the main connections.
VI EARTHING The panels shall be provided with Tinned copper earth bus running through the length of the switch
board. The earth bus shall be projected on either side of the panel with suitable size bolts at the end
shall be provided to connect the same to the earth grid at the site.
VII INSPECTION At all reasonable times during manufacturing and prior to despatch the supplier shall provide and
secure for purchasers representative every reasonable access and facility at their place for inspection
approval.
VIII DEVIATION Any deviation in Technical / commercial can be communicated along with the bid. However, the bank
reserves right to accept (or) reject.
MODE OF MEASUREMENT for Furnishing Works 1 Doors & windows:
Clear areas over one face inclusive of frame shall be measured. Hold fasts and portions embedded in
masonry or flooring shall not be measured.
2 Grills: Clear area of grill shall be measured.
3 Partitions in Woodwork The partition height shall be measured upto bottom of false ceiling and framing members / ply going
above shall not be measured.
4 Decorative panelling over wall: The area of cladding shall be measured in square metres. The gross area covered will be measured.
5 False Ceiling: For false ceiling work, the measurement shall be for the actual area covered. No deductions shall be
made for cut-outs for light fittings, speakers etc.
6 Wood work: For conversion of inches to feet & cm to metre, the resultant figure shall be taken upto two digits after
decimal point. Third digit shall not be taken into account.
7 Boxing of Windows: Actual area of boxing will be measured. Size of wooden frame will not be included in the measurement.
8 Storage Units:
Area will be calculated as length, measured on front face multiplied by height of unit.
9 Paintings:
Windows & grills: Clear area of front face shall be measured. It will include painting rebates in frame,
shutters, beadings & both sides of grill.
Walls: Area of wall upto bottom of false ceiling will be measured. No separate quantity for cornice will
be measured.
